Released March 2nd, 1930, 'Strictly Modern' stars Dorothy Mackaill, Sidney Blackmer, Julanne Johnston, Warner Richmond The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 3 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which assembled reviews from well-known users.

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Strictly Modern is a 1930 American pre-Code comedy film directed by William A. Seiter and starring Dorothy Mackaill and Sidney Blackmer. A lady novelist falls deeply in love." .
